35 Secret Hideouts of Fictional Heroes

Millennium-falcon

To the Batcave! Now if only Google Maps would show us where that was ...

Every hero needs a hideaway. Han Solo has the Millennium Falcon, the Avengers have their mansion and Spider-Man has Aunt May's house. Though the real hero is behind the mask or cape, their residencies are often critical to the character, as a place of sanctuary or simply a mark of their beginnings.

See also: How Well Can You Recognize Famous Film Locations?

The fictional headquarters of heroes are so insanely cool, they deserve their own comic book. Or at least a closer look

This illustrated flip book, created by real estate agency Movoto, showcases 35 residencies of some of pop culture's bravest heroes. Each slide gives a little background on the importance and origins of that particular character and his home (or castle/jet/cave away from home). Read more...
